Product Information

Extended Description

3AXD50000864300 ABB: The ACQ580-31 ultra-low harmonic (ULH) irrigation wall-mounted drive provides an unprecedented compact design that delivers unity power factor with a 3% or less THiD. By meeting the most stringent requirement of the IEEE519 recommendations, the ACQ580 ULH irrigation drive produces the least amount of harmonic distortion to reduce stress on electrical equipment. The ACQ580-31 irrigation wall-mounted drives are available from 40-150 HP at 460V 3-phase. The drives are available in UL Type 1 (IP21).=20 =20 The irrigation specific software is designed for irrigation applications, enabling easily programmed functions and protections. This innovative programming includes, quick ramps, level control, flow calculations, flow and pressure protection, dry pump protection, soft pipe fill, and others. These drives include fieldbus, I/O modules, and other options available for the ACQ580 irrigation packages.
